Local Whisky rum etc will cost anywhere between 10 and 35 rupees a peg or 30 Ml depending on where you are drinking. Feni can be had for as cheap as 5 rupees a peg.
For foreign made Brands like Bacardi expect to pay more, something like 40-70 a peg.

A bottle of Local brand whisky rum etc will set you back 100- 150 rupees. Not sure how much a bottle of Bacardi or Scottish Whisky will cost you I never buy it!!

Latest prices per case of Kings (12 pints) is 170/- per case (plus deposit which is returned on giving the empty bottles back). Kingfisher case (660ml big bottles) is available for 330/- - 350/- (plus deposit of course)

Kings is definately a better choice.

One should also try local beer BELLO. I found it a great taste at down to earth price. Case is priced at less than 300/- for 12 Big bottles.

Royal Stag Whisky is for 170/-, Royal Challange for 280/-.
